Almost every week there’s a news item related to electric or low emission vehicles, including many new car launches. Yet sales of electric vehicles are increasing at a sluggish rate and some way off what is required to achieve the automotive industry’s vision. So what is the latest future for electric and hybrid cars?

Towards the end of 2011 we invited transport professionals to complete a simple survey on our website voting the one of three visions for electric vehicles they thought would be most likely to reflect the reality by 2025. We then repeated the survey a year later to see how views have changed – and there is a noticeable difference, with a greater number of professionals sceptical about the future of the electric vehicle.
